Catriona Strang is a member of the Kootenay School of Writing collective and a founding member of the Institute for Domestic Research.
Her first book of poetry is Low Fancy (ECW, 1993), a translation of the mediaeval, vernacular Latin songs known collectively as the Carmina Burana from 13th century Western Europe.
Strang's 2022 collection of poetry Unfuckable Lardass (Talonbooks $16.95) takes its title from an outrageous insult directed at the former German Chancellor, Angela Merkel. Strang channeled her rage and grief at this disgraceful display of sexism through her new poems. By reflecting on more loving and enlightened possibilities, and viewing people in a holistic way including every individual’s complex personal story, Strang ameliorates destructive and unjust patriarchal treatments.

In Reveries of a Solitary Biker
(Talonbooks $16.95), Catriona Strang’s poetry ponders the difficulties of living an anti-capitalist life; the invisibility of much of women’s labour; and the complexities of sustainability as she cycles around Vancouver. These poems reference and pay homage to Jean-Jacques Rousseau’s unfinished 1776 manuscript of obsession, Reveries of the Solitary Walker. With cycling, Strang finds it particularly conducive to slow, non-deliberate thinking. She lives in Vancouver and has publicly performed parts of Reveries of a Solitary Biker with clarinetist François Houle.
